#030e93 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#030e93 is composed of 1.2% red, 5.5%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 90.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 235.4 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 29.4%. #030e93 color hex could be obtained by blending #061cff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#030e93 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#030e93 has RGB values of R:3, G:14,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 200339.

Shades and Tints of #030e93
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010c is the darkest color, while #f8f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#030e93
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#48494e is the less saturated color, while #030e93 is the most saturated one.
